Hilary Hahn

Paris (CD)

Star violinist Hilary Hahn presents her new album Paris with a very personal selection of works.

The focus of Paris for this album grew out of Hilary Hahn’s longtime collaboration with the Orchestre Philharmonique de Radio France and its music director, the Finnish conductor Mikko Franck.
Even though only one of the recorded works is by a French composer, all three originated in Paris.
